Abstract
Esterified alkoxylated mono- and diglycerides suitable for use as reduced calorie fat substitutes in food products may be produced by alkoxylating a tertiary alkyl partial ether of glycerin with an epoxide and then reacting the alkoxylated glycerin tertiary alkyl partial ether thereby obtained with a fatty acid under acid-catalyzed conditions. Separate deprotection and esterification steps are not required, resulting in a considerably streamlined process as compared to alternative methods of synthesizing alkoxylated fat substitutes having one or two fatty acid acyl groups attached directly to glycerin.
